Capstone Turbine Corporation • 21211 Nordhoff Street • Chatsworth • CA 91311 • USA Service Bulletin SB0041: External Battery Wake Connections – Model C60 MicroTurbine 4. The nominal 12V source JUCB J10-7 (JUCB_BAT_PWR) and ground return JUCB J16-4 (GROUND) may be used to power the wake signal circuit. This is done by combining these two terminals with a contact closure in an external circuit, to apply the wake signal from JUCB J10-3 (ISO B-START+) to JUCB J10-2 (ISO B-START-), as shown in Figure 1. When the wake signal is being applied, up to 5W may be taken from this source. When the wake signal is not being applied, no power is drawn from this source. NOTE Power taken from this source will drain the Auxiliary battery in the UCB. If this battery becomes discharged, the MicroTurbine will not start. Wire length up to 100 feet EXTERNAL SYSTEM External contact Normally open Closes for 0.1s to 2s to start MicroTurbine User Connection Bay J10-7 (JUCB_BAT_PWR) J10-3 (ISO B-START+) J10-2 (ISO B-START-) J16-4 (GROUND) Figure 1. Interface circuit for JUCB battery start input from an external circuit contact closure of duration between 0.1 second and 2 seconds. 5. Dual-mode installations should also be wired to terminals JUCB J10-3 (ISO B-START+) and JUCB J10-2 (ISO B-START-) as follows: New DMC Installations – Refer to the DMC Application Guide 513000. If Table 7 of the Application Guide shows that the DMC terminal 7 (BATTERY START A) is connected to JUCB J10-6, then disconnect it from JUCB J10-6. Instead, connect DMC terminal 7 to JUCB J10-3 (ISO B-START+), and install a jumper in the JUCB from JUCB J10-2 (ISO B-START-) to JUCB J16-4 (GROUND). The final configuration should be as shown in Figure 1. Existing DMC Installations - In the JUCB move the DMC terminal 7 connection from JUCB J10-6 (BAT_START) to JUCB J10-3 (ISO B-START+), and install a jumper in the JUCB from JUCB J10-2 (ISO B-START-) to JUCB J16-4 (GROUND).
